## Further Reading

The Wrenmoor gateway performs two distinct checks behind the Copperline load balancer: a shallow TCP probe every five seconds and a deep dependency check every thirty. Only the shallow probe affects rotation; the deep check feeds alerting. Maintainers should be careful not to conflate the two, since a failing deep check with a passing shallow probe means the node stays in rotation while degraded. The full probe configuration, threshold rationale, and historical tuning decisions are recorded on the internal design page.

operations page: https://confluence.tolvaqsys.corp/spaces/pages/pages/6e787158f507

Blocking: the reconciliation job diffs the full Stockhaven catalog every run, even when upstream deltas cover <2% of SKUs. That's fine at current volume but will blow the batch window after the Halwick warehouse onboards. Switch to delta-first with a weekly full sweep before cutting the release. Also, the retry loop has no jitter — three workers hammering the same locked rows is why Tuesday's run took 4h. I've parameterized the knobs so ops can tune without a redeploy; current defaults below.

tuning table, yajog-yahof:
BUDGETS = {
    "lamvan": 303,
    "wenox": 460,
    "fenvan": 525,
}

Subject: Handover — Whisperhall audio-guide DB

Hi Dorinda,

Handing over DBA duties for the Whisperhall museum audio-guide app before the Gallery Nocturne release. Please review carefully: the narration-assets table was repartitioned last week, and the tour-progress writes now go through a queue rather than direct inserts. Backups run nightly at 02:15; verify the restore job once before sign-off. For your review environment, connect to the staging database using the string below.

Thanks, Ozren

replica DSN, kajep-yahag: mssql://praok_svc:iF@db-8d68.plorvaio.local:5432/eliion